Saltstack 事件未触发或反应器系统未响应

Saltstack events not firing or reactor system not responding

我正在使用以下命令从 salt minion 触发事件:

salt-call event.send 'kubemaster/kubernetes/started' '{master_ip:"10.102.28.170"}'

主人有reactor配置:

reactor:
- kubemaster/kubernetes/started:
  - /srv/reactor/testfile.sls

在主调试模式下,我可以看到消息总线上的事件,但它没有显示任何关于呈现 sls 文件的消息

[DEBUG   ] Gathering reactors for tag kubemaster/kubernetes/started
[DEBUG   ] Compiling reactions for tag kubemaster/kubernetes/started
[DEBUG   ] LazyLoaded local_cache.prep_jid

有没有更好的调试方法? 有什么方法可以检查它是否正在寻找 sls 文件?

谢谢!

可能是 copy/paste 错误,但您在粘贴的反应器配置中缺少第二行和第三行的缩进级别。